How much does it cost to rent a home in Northeast?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northeast 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,512 | $904 | $1,900 |
| Northeast 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,056 | $1,600 | $4,100 |
| Northeast 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,945 | $810 | $2,375 |
| Northeast 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,449 | $2,300 | $2,599 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Northeast
What type of rentals are currently available in Northeast?
There are currently 111 Apartments for Rent in Northeast, FL with pricing that ranges from $735 to $3,339. There are also 74 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Northeast ranging from $784 to $4,100.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Northeast?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Northeast ranges from $784 to $4,100 with an average monthly rent of $1,807.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Northeast?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Northeast range from $1,450 to $3,339,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,600 to $4,100.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$810 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,800.
